Miscellaneous Information for Warsaw ...

The Federal government has assigned various identifying codes to each community, county and state. At one time or another, the US Census Bureau has used one (or more) of the following identifiers when referring to either Sumter County or the community of Warsaw:

  • The GNIS Codes ...
    • The current system of identification is called the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S). The following GNIS codes relate to Warsaw:
    • GNIS ID for Warsaw: 153894
    • GNIS ID for Sumter County: 161585
    • GNIS ID for State of Alabama: 1779775
  • The FIPS Codes ...
    • An earlier (and largely obsolete) identification method was called the Federal Information Processing Standard (FIPS):
    • State Code: 01 (Alabama)
    • County Code: 119 (Sumter County)
    • Place Code: 79992 (Warsaw)
    • State & County Code: 01/119 (Alabama / Sumter County)
    • State & Place Code: 01/79992 (Alabama / Warsaw)
  • Misc. Census Codes ...
    • Warsaw is located in Census Region #3 (the South Region) and Division #6 (the East South-Central Division).
